Nürnberg is a lovely old city which can take the visitor back to the romantic eras of the middle ages. Nürnberg is also a horrific reminder of the evils of 1930s and 40s Nazi Germany. I much preferred visiting the old town and letting the charm of Nürnberg do its magic on me. Yet, the old remnants of Hitler's grandiosity must also be seen, though to do so will mean a sorrowful heart. |
